3. Synopsis of Episode 10

Title (implied): "Sultan's Real Friend" or "Uang Bukan Segalanya" (Money Isn't Everything)

Plot Summary:

  • Opening: Episode 10 begins with Sultan feeling bored despite having just bought an entire amusement park. His assistant, Ujang, suggests he invite friends over.
  • Conflict: Sultan uses his wealth to "buy" friends for a day—paying classmates millions of rupiah to attend his private cinema and gourmet snack party. However, during a game, Sultan realizes that no one is genuinely interested in him; they only stay for the money and gifts.
  • Climax: A new student, Adit, from a modest background, refuses Sultan's money and instead shares a simple homemade snack. Adit challenges Sultan to play traditional games (e.g., gobak sodor, marbles) without using any money. Sultan loses initially but finds genuine joy in the activity.
  • Resolution: Sultan dismisses the paid friends and spends the rest of the day with Adit. The episode ends with Sultan telling Ujang, “Ternyata ada yang lebih keren dari uang. Teman sejati.” (Turns out there’s something cooler than money. A real friend.)
